Processing copyright Withdrawals for Brokers: Security and Speed

copyright withdrawals for brokers pose a unique set of challenges. Balancing swift transaction processing with robust security measures is critical. Brokers must implement multi-layered security protocols to protect user funds from malicious actors.

This encompasses rigorous KYC/AML compliance, integrating multi-factor authentication (MFA), and maintaining cold storage solutions for majority copyright holdings.

Simultaneously, brokers should strive to enhance withdrawal speeds by implementing advanced blockchain technology and streamlining internal processes. A frictionless withdrawal experience encourages user trust and satisfaction in the volatile world of cryptocurrencies.
